Figured I'd do a little update since there's nothing out here started orientation at the beginning of this week they don't bring tons of people in on bus I hitched a ride with a driver which was nice got his opinion on the company and then justbasic oorientation nothing fancy just me and one other guy in there they have a bunk house at the terminal so no motel and if you pass drug test and drive test after a few days your on the road so far I like what I see talked to a lot drivers over the past week everyone I talked to has been there 5+ years and seem to like it. All in all sounds like a great place to work.

Ya no problem so far I have to say I'm really liking it they keep ya moving other than waiting on customer unloads the longest I've waited for reload info is 10min. Customers I've waited as long as 2 hrs to get unloaded but all in all pretty good. Lot of drop and hook I've been doing nice trucks entire fleet of petes nothing fancy but they are pete trade them in every couple years any questions just ask ill help the best I can
